    Hasselback chicken is a delicious way to make chicken breast using the same method as for Hasselback potatoes. Hasselback potatoes are quite popular nowadays.

    The name "Hasselback" comes from the Hasselbacken restaurant in Stockholm, Sweden. Hasselback potatoes were created in 1953 by Leif Ellison from Värmland, who was trainee chef at restaurant Hasselbacken on Djurgården in Stockholm.

    Hasselback chicken is a chicken breast made in the style of Hasselback potatoes. It is a delicious and surprising method for making not only potatoes.

    Prep Time 15 mins
    Cook Time 25 mins
    Total Time 40 mins
    Course lunch, Main Course, oven dish
    Cuisine European
    Servings 1 person

    Ingredients
      

    • 1 chicken breast
    • ¼ bell pepper red
    • 5 cherry tomatoes
    • feta cheese handful
    • basil leaves
    • pepper
    • salt
    • chili powder
    • grated Parmezan

    Instructions
     

    • Place the chicken breast between two wooden spoons (or something similar to prevent cutting them through) and slice it with a distance of app. 1,5 cm.
    • Cut the vegetables and the feta into very small pieces.
    • Season the chicken breast with salt and pepper.
    • Fill the slices with the mixture of the vegetables and the feta.
    • Finish with chilli powder and the parmesan cheese.
    • Put it in a preheated oven of 180°C for 25 minutes.
